Come join a team of dedicated staff at an exceptional time in the Smithsonian’s history: the creation of the Smithsonian American Women's History Museum. Decades in the making, the Smithsonian American Women’s History Museum will recognize women’s accomplishments, the history they made, and the communities they represent. To create a more equitable America, the Smithsonian American Women’s History Museum is researching, disseminating, and amplifying women’s stories to ensure the role of women in American history is well-known, accurate, acknowledged, and empowering. The legislation creating the Smithsonian American Women’s History Museum was established by Congress in December 2020.
Key Responsibilities
The Smithsonian American Women’s History Museum seeks a Membership Marketing Specialist who manages the membership program with particular emphasis on providing excellent customer service to members and the public. The incumbent works with a direct marketing agency to develop multi-channel marketing messaging and campaigns including direct mail, online, text and telemarketing content and strategy. The Membership Marketing Specialist will serve as program liaison, working with museum advancement staff to execute membership program and operations; help develop program strategy and messaging and manage program structure, marketing and operations; coordinate and maintain master direct response and member/donor contact schedule; serve as liaison to vendors; oversee and deploy campaigns through multiple channels in partnership with vendors and internal staff; coordinate benefit fulfillment and cultivation mailings; and work with vendors for data analysis and reporting.
Skills, Knowledge, and Expertise
Applicants must have a minimum of three years of experience in direct response fundraising. The ideal candidate will have experience developing campaigns for diverse and multigenerational audiences. Knowledge of membership strategy, operations and Microsoft Office is desired. Strong organizational, relationship, collaboration, and communication skills as well as the ability to work independently are essential. Applications should demonstrate the ability to coordinate complex procedures and to manage multiple projects simultaneously. The successful candidate will have a passion for learning and exploration, and the desire to join an innovative and growing operation.
